Nature and Trails

The Étang de Bétête covers 1.5 hectares; fishing is possible there for a full day or half a day.

Culture and Townscape

The church of Bétête is of Romanesque origin and dates back to the 12th century. Its bell tower has a square base typical of the Creuse, which transitions into an octagonal spire. The Église de Bétête was open to the public.

The Lavoir de la Font-Pérenche is a traditional covered washhouse with granite washing slabs.

In the centre of Bétête stands a typical house from the 1920s and 1930s, built in the style of Norman seaside villas. This house is an architectural curiosity in the centre of Bétête.

Further Historical Traces

At the Abbaye de Prébenoît, the staircase area and room A5 are decorated with early 18th-century wall paintings. The depictions show the abbey, flowers and floral ornaments.

Only a door decorated with a three-lobed arch and some remnants of the walls remain from the Gothic chapel of the Abbaye de Prébenoît.
